Addressing the Launch Backlog
The current backlog in satellite launches stems from multiple interconnected factors, creating a complex challenge for the Space Force. Addressing these bottlenecks requires a multi-pronged approach focused on improving processes, supply chains, and testing capabilities.
Bottlenecks in the Acquisition Process
The acquisition process for new space systems is notoriously complex and time-consuming. Bureaucratic hurdles significantly impede the timely development and launch of satellites.
- Excessive Paperwork: Redundant documentation and approval processes add unnecessary delays.
- Lengthy Approval Cycles: Multiple layers of review and sign-off contribute to project stagnation.
- Lack of Streamlined Processes: Inefficient workflows and a lack of digitalization hamper progress.
- Funding Limitations: Insufficient budgetary allocation restricts the resources available for timely completion.
For example, the delayed launch of the X-37B spaceplane program highlighted the challenges of navigating this complex system, resulting in significant cost overruns and schedule slippage. Streamlining the acquisition process through digital transformation and improved project management is crucial for faster deployment.
Improving Supply Chain Management
The space industry's reliance on a global supply chain introduces significant vulnerabilities. Disruptions can lead to critical component shortages and project delays.
- Dependence on Foreign Suppliers: Over-reliance on international suppliers creates risks associated with geopolitical instability and trade restrictions.
- Material Shortages: Demand for specialized materials often outstrips supply, leading to production bottlenecks.
- Logistics Challenges: The complex logistics involved in transporting sensitive components across international borders introduce potential delays.
- Cybersecurity Risks: The digital nature of supply chains increases vulnerability to cyberattacks, potentially disrupting production and launch schedules.
Solutions include diversifying suppliers, investing in domestic manufacturing capabilities for critical components, implementing robust inventory management systems, and strengthening cybersecurity protocols across the supply chain. A resilient and diversified supply chain is essential for ensuring timely satellite launches.
Enhancing Testing and Integration Capabilities
Rigorous testing is crucial for identifying and resolving potential issues before launch. Investing in advanced testing facilities and methodologies is vital for accelerating the deployment timeline.
- Investment in Advanced Testing Facilities: Modernized facilities capable of simulating the harsh conditions of space are needed.
- Adoption of Innovative Testing Methodologies: Utilizing advanced simulation and modeling techniques can significantly reduce testing time and costs.
- Simulated Space Environments: Creating realistic space environments for testing improves the reliability and accuracy of testing results.
- Improved Quality Control: Strengthening quality control procedures throughout the development cycle minimizes potential failures and delays.
Thorough testing minimizes the risk of costly failures during launch and operation, ensuring mission success and reducing overall project timelines.
Optimizing Satellite Launch Operations
Optimizing launch operations requires modernizing infrastructure, leveraging commercial partnerships, and exploring advanced launch technologies.
Modernizing Launch Infrastructure
The current launch infrastructure needs upgrades to increase launch frequency and efficiency.
- Investment in New Launch Sites: Expanding launch capacity through the construction of new facilities is crucial.
- Upgrades to Existing Facilities: Modernizing existing infrastructure to improve efficiency and safety is essential.
- Development of Reusable Launch Vehicles: Reusable launch systems significantly reduce launch costs and increase launch frequency.
- Improved Launch Scheduling Systems: Efficient scheduling systems minimize launch delays and optimize resource allocation.
Investing in modernized launch infrastructure reduces launch costs and increases the frequency of satellite deployments.
Leveraging Commercial Partnerships
Public-private partnerships are critical for accelerating satellite launches by leveraging the innovation and efficiency of commercial space companies.
- Public-Private Partnerships: Collaboration with commercial entities can bring expertise and resources to government projects.
- Leveraging Private Sector Innovation: Commercial companies often develop cutting-edge technologies that can be adapted for government use.
- Reducing Reliance on Government-Only Launches: Increased reliance on commercial launch providers reduces pressure on government resources.
- Competitive Bidding Processes: Competitive bidding ensures cost-effectiveness and drives innovation.
Successful examples like SpaceX's collaboration with NASA demonstrate the benefits of public-private partnerships in space exploration.
Developing Advanced Launch Technologies
Exploring and implementing cutting-edge launch technologies can significantly enhance speed and efficiency.
- Hypersonic Launch Vehicles: Hypersonic vehicles can dramatically reduce transit times to orbit.
- Reusable Launch Systems: Reusable rockets significantly lower the cost per launch.
- Space-Based Launch Platforms: Launching from space eliminates atmospheric drag and reduces fuel requirements.
- Advanced Propulsion Systems: New propulsion technologies offer increased efficiency and payload capacity.
While these technologies present challenges, their potential benefits justify significant investment in research and development.
